Hello, I’m Julian Miranda. I hold a B.S and M.S in Mathematics, specializing in mathematical modeling. My research on magnetohydrodynamic flow simulations, supported by a National Science Foundation grant, showcases my expertise in programming languages like Python, C++, and MATLAB. I optimized simulations, reduced time complexity, and implemented random forest techniques, achieving a 4.75% error rate.
My academic achievements include an undergraduate major GPA of 4.0 and a graduate GPA of 3.8. Since graduating, I have utilized ML algorithms for a number of applications such as disease classification, forecasting residential property values, conducting sentiment analysis on COVID-19 data, predicting heating and cooling loads in residential buildings, and more.
